What's for Dinner, Sat., Dec. 14, 2024 [View all]

Butternut squash ravioli with pesto.

Spinach, green ruffly lettuce, and arugula salad with fennel and apple sliced on the mandoline. Homemade citrus vinaigrette using crushed fennel seed and also whole fennel seed sprinkled over the salad.

Pomegranate kombucha.

Dessert: My friend dropped off Middle Eastern date cookies last night. They are a filled cookie. The cookie's exterior is like a shortbread. Inside is the date filling. There is a design on the cookie. Ever since he started traveling to the Middle East for work, he brings these cookies back and I get a few of them every now and then.
